区块链技术支撑:深入解析其核心组成与应用前

                    在当今数字化的浪潮之中,区块链技术如同一颗璀璨的明珠,以其独特的去中心化特性引领着各行各业的创新与变革。随着区块链技术的不断演进与发展,它所蕴含的潜力不仅改变了金融领域的面貌,还渗透到了供应链管理、医疗健康、身份认证等众多领域。那么,究竟哪些技术支撑着区块链的运作呢?本文将对此进行深入探讨,并展望其应用前景。 ### 区块链技术的基本构成

                    区块链作为一种分布式账本技术,其基本构成可以分为几个核心要素:去中心化、数据结构、共识机制、加密算法、智能合约等。

                    #### 去中心化

                    传统的中心化系统往往由单一的服务器或机构来管理与维护数据,这容易导致数据泄露、篡改等安全问题。而区块链则通过网络中的多个节点共同维护数据,每个节点都有相同的数据副本,这种去中心化的特性大大提升了系统的安全性与可靠性。

                    #### 数据结构

                    区块链的核心数据结构是区块(Block)和链(Chain)。每个区块包含了一定数量的交易数据、时间戳以及前一个区块的哈希值。哈希值的存在确保了区块间的顺序性,以及防篡改的能力。反过来说,一旦区块被篡改,其后所有区块的哈希值也会发生变化,从而易于识别。

                    #### 共识机制

                    共识机制是区块链网络中所有节点达成一致的规则。最常见的共识机制包括工作量证明(PoW)、权益证明(PoS)、授权权益证明(DPoS)等。每种机制都有其优缺点,但都旨在确保网络中参与者能够在没有中心化权威的情况下,共同维护账本的有效性与一致性。

                    #### 加密算法

                    区块链依赖于强大的加密算法以确保数据安全与隐私。常用的加密方法包括对称加密与非对称加密。对称加密使用相同的密钥进行加解密,而非对称加密则使用一对密钥(公钥和私钥)来保障交易的安全性。有效的加密措施能够防止数据被非法篡改或窃取。

                    #### 智能合约

                    智能合约是自动执行、不可篡改的协议。它们在特定条件达到时自动执行预设的指令。这一特性使得区块链不仅限于数据存储与交易记录,还可以承载复杂的业务逻辑,从而在众多领域发挥其潜在价值。

                    ### 区块链的实际应用

                    区块链技术的应用场景广泛而多样,尤其在金融、供应链、医疗健康、身份认证等领域展现了巨大潜力。

                    #### 1. 金融领域

                    在金融领域,区块链技术最早的应用便是比特币以及其他加密货币。比特币是一种去中心化、无需中介的数字货币,极大地降低了交易成本和时间。此外,区块链还可用于跨境支付、资产交易、安全存储等方面,提升了交易的透明度与回溯性。

                    #### 2. 供应链管理

                    供应链管理是区块链技术应用的另一个重要领域。通过将整个供应链的信息记录在区块链上,各参与者可以即时查看产品的来源、生产过程和运输状态。这种透明性不仅提高了供应链的效率,还增强了消费者的信任感。比如,某些食品企业已开始利用区块链追踪农产品的来源,以确保其安全性与质量。

                    #### 3. 医疗健康

                    区块链技术同样可以保障医疗数据的安全与隐私。通过建立一个安全的医疗信息共享平台,患者可以自行管理其医疗记录,并在需要时与医生、安全共享,从而降低医疗错误率。此外,区块链还可以用于药品追踪、临床试验数据管理等领域。

                    #### 4. 身份认证

                    在身份认证领域,区块链为个人身份信息的管理提供了全新的解决方案。通过区块链技术,个人可以对自己的身份信息进行控制,减少身份盗用的风险。例如,区块链可以用于电子护照、投票系统等领域,从而提高安全性与效率。

                    ### 区块链面临的挑战与未来展望 虽然区块链技术的应用前景广阔,但其发展过程中也面临着诸多挑战。接下来我们将探讨一些主要问题。 #### 1. 区块链技术的安全性问题

                    虽然区块链本身通过加密算法及去中心化特性提高了安全性,但其应用层面仍存在诸多安全隐患。比如,智能合约的漏洞、黑客攻击等都有可能导致资金损失和数据泄露。因此,如何提升区块链及其智能合约代码的安全性,是未来发展的重点。

                    #### 2. 监管与合规问题

                    随着区块链技术的不断发展,如何进行有效的监管亦成为一个重要课题。地方政府和国际组织已开始着手制定相关法律法规,但由于区块链的去中心化特性,很多传统的法律框架已明显不适用。因此,需要关注区块链在法律监管上的创新与突破。

                    #### 3. 技术标准化问题

                    目前,区块链技术尚缺乏全球统一的标准规格。这导致不同平台、应用之间很难互联互通,从而限制了区块链的普遍应用。因此,推动区块链技术的标准化将是行业发展的重要趋势。

                    #### 4. 可扩展性问题

                    区块链在处理交易的速度与数量上仍存在限制。例如,以太坊网络在高峰期时常会因为交易过多而出现拥堵,导致交易费大幅上涨。因此,如何提升区块链的扩展性,增强其处理能力,将是技术发展的核心挑战。

                    #### 5. 用户教育与认知

                    很多用户对区块链仍持有消极态度或缺乏了解。对于区块链的安全性、透明性和使用场景的不理解,限制了其推广。因此,教育与宣传是未来推广区块链技术的重要环节,希望能够提高公众的认知水平,从而推动其应用落地。

                    ### 可能相关问题 1. 区块链与传统数据库有何不同? 2. 区块链的可持续性如何? 3. 如何在区块链上进行开发? 4. 区块链技术应用的未来趋势是什么? 5. 如何选择合适的区块链平台? 通过以上对区块链技术支撑的深入解析与应用前景的展望,我们期待着这项革命性技术为社会带来的更多可能性与变革。未来,区块链不仅将成为一技术,更将变革我们的生活、工作与交流方式,为人类创造崭新的价值。
                                    author

                                    Appnox App

                                    content here', making it look like readable English. Many desktop publishing is packages and web page editors now use

                                                  related post

                                                        leave a reply